Steroids are synthetic variations of the male sex hormone testosterone. They are often used in medicine to treat various conditions but have gained significant attention in the world of bodybuilding and sports. Bodybuilders and athletes may use steroids to enhance performance, increase muscle mass, and improve recovery times. However, the use of steroids is controversial and comes with a range of potential side effects.

How Steroids Work

Steroids facilitate muscle growth and enhance physical performance primarily through the following mechanisms:

  1. Increased Protein Synthesis: Steroids promote the creation of proteins, which are essential for muscle repair and growth.
  2. Reduced Muscle Breakdown: They help minimize muscle catabolism, allowing athletes to train harder and recover faster.
  3. Enhanced Red Blood Cell Production: Some steroids can increase the production of red blood cells, improving oxygen delivery to muscles.

Types of Steroids Used in Bodybuilding

Bodybuilders may utilize various types of steroids, including:

  1. Anabolic Steroids: These are designed to promote muscle growth.
  2. Androgenic Steroids: These can enhance the development of male characteristics.
  3. Combining Steroids: Many athletes use a combination, known as stacking, to maximize their effects.

Potential Effects of Steroid Use

While steroids can provide several benefits for bodybuilders, they are also associated with a range of adverse effects, including:

  1. Hormonal Imbalances: Steroid use can lead to changes in hormone levels, resulting in issues such as gynecomastia in men.
  2. Acne and Skin Issues: Steroids can cause skin problems and acne in users.
  3. Cardiovascular Risks: Increased risk of heart disease and hypertension.
  4. Liver Damage: Oral steroids, in particular, can be toxic to the liver.
  5. Psychological Effects: Mood swings, aggression, and anxiety can result from prolonged steroid use.
